Output ec289787691ddf0d5f89986bec542509e40364c9a5f339dc6651c15b887be3ab:0

value
215469
script pubkey
OP_0 OP_PUSHBYTES_20 b34393952a1c7f21c16ed39b55f141e91938dfb5
address
bc1qkdpe89f2r3ljrstw6wd4tu2payvn3ha4ne2xqq
transaction
ec289787691ddf0d5f89986bec542509e40364c9a5f339dc6651c15b887be3ab
spent
true